The MAKO JAWS RailFin Screed Support System provides fast, repeatable elevation control for concrete placement using 1/4" Flat Rolled screed rails. Designed for slab-on-grade and adjustable deck installations, the system allows contractors to set screed supports quickly while maintaining consistent grade throughout the pour.

Internal "FINS" grip the mounting structure helping prevent the chair from bouncing off during concrete placement. An ideal mounting structure is 1/2" however 3/8" or 5/8" can be used.

The JAWS RailFin is installed onto a mounting structure such as rebar, all-thread, GFRP, PVC, or conduit. For slab-on-grade placements, the MAKO Driver allows contractors to drive the support directly to finished elevation using a string line or laser reference.

For elevated placements, the JAWS RailFin can be used with adjustable stand systems to precisely position screed rails over decks or vapor barriers.

THREADED ROD LENGTH DEPENDS ON SLAB THICKNESS 

Cut the threaded rod or coil rod based on the slab thickness using the recommended lengths from the slab depth chart. 

SLAB DEPTH RECOMMENDED ROD LENGTH
4.5" - 6.25" 2.25"
5.5" - 7.25" 3.25"
6.5" - 8.25" 4.25"
7.5" - 9.25" 5.25"
8.5" - 10.25" 6.25"
9.5" - 11.25" 7.25"
10.5" - 12.25" 8.25"

For slabs greater than 6" we recommend using a steel threaded rod instead of nylon.

1-3/4" VERTICAL ADJUSTMENT

Using the nut and washers, the FinStand or CoilStand allows up to 1-3/4" of vertical adjustment, enabling precise height control and easy grade adjustments during setup.

 

 MINIMUM THREAD ENGAGEMENT REQUIRED FOR STABILITY IN SETUP

Two diagrams showing incorrect and correct ways to use a stand with a fin, marked by red 'X' symbols.

Proper setup is essential when using the FinCap or JAWS screed chairs on elevated decks or vapor barrier slabs. The threaded rod must be installed a minimum of 1" into the barrel of the screed chair and 1/2" into the FinStand to maintain stability. If these engagement depths are not met, the assembly may become unstable and move during concrete placement.
